Protein crystallography data
The structure of Crystallographic and Kinetic Studies of Human Mitochondrial Acetoacetyl-Coa Thiolase (T2): the Importance of Potassium and Chloride For Its Structure and Function, PDB code: 2ibw
was solved by
A.M.Haapalainen,
R.K.Wierenga,
with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:
Resolution Low / High (Å)
|
48.22 /
1.90
|
Space group
|
P 1 21 1
|
Cell size a, b, c (Å), α, β, γ (°)
|
76.143,
107.577,
101.954,
90.00,
102.89,
90.00
|
R / Rfree (%)
|
15.3 /
19.5
|
